Bishop R. C. Lawson, Establishmentarian of the COOLJC prayed to God for ten years for a national organization and program which would include all of the women of COOLJC. His prayers were answered in 1952 when God gave the late Mother Delphia Perry a vision for an Auxiliary which would include every woman in the organization. The purpose of the Auxiliary would be to "help foster the gospel, educate and help mankind at home and in foreign lands."
The International Womens Conference has evolved under the leadership of Mother Celestine Peters and their mission is to promote Christian and Secular Education of Sisters. Christian Education is being promoted by using the word of God to bring knowledge that would enrich sisters to identify their gifts, talents and purpose as it relates to the will of God concerning them and secular education is being promoted by encouraging and empowering sisters of all ages to aim for the highest possible education in the secular world, academically, vocationally, technically and etc. To mentor our youth of today, sociallly and educationally, providing them with guidance and instruction.
